Biography

Ada Hurst is an Associate Professor in the Teaching Stream at the University of Waterloo, specializing in Management Science Engineering. She has been a design educator and researcher with a strong emphasis on engineering design courses in the Management Engineering program since 2011. Her teaching includes foundational courses in organizational behavior and technology, as well as capstone design projects. Hurst's research interests lie in engineering design cognition, design management, and design learning. She focuses on how artificial intelligence impacts these areas and aims to facilitate and enhance the design process through research and education. In addition, she co-founded the Canadian Design Workshop, which promotes design education and research in Canada. Hurst has received multiple awards for her contributions to research and education, including the Distinguished Performance Award from the Faculty of Engineering at the University of Waterloo and various best paper awards in her field. Her work has been published in leading engineering and design education journals. Recent research projects have been funded by SSHRC Learning Innovation grants, aiming to enhance teaching and learning practices in engineering education.
